Microphotograph is a 15 letter word which starts with the letter M and ends with the letter H for which we found 2 definitions.

(n.) A microscopically small photograph of a picture writing printed page etc.
(n.) An enlarged representation of a microscopic object produced by throwing upon a sensitive plate the magnified image of an object formed by a microscope or other suitable combination of lenses.
